#[repr(C)]pub struct VkVideoEncodeH264PictureInfoKHR {
pub sType: VkStructureType,
pub pNext: *const c_void,
pub naluSliceEntryCount: u32,
pub pNaluSliceEntries: *const VkVideoEncodeH264NaluSliceInfoKHR,
pub pStdPictureInfo: *const StdVideoEncodeH264PictureInfo,
pub generatePrefixNalu: VkBool32,
}Fields§
